Top Moruya Attractions

  • 1. Eurobodalla National Park: This beautiful national park offers stunning coastal scenery, lush forests, and diverse wildlife. Visitors can enjoy hiking, picnicking, camping, and birdwatching.
  • 2. Moruya Museum: This local museum showcases the history and heritage of Moruya and the surrounding region. It features exhibits on Aboriginal culture, European settlement, maritime history, and more.
  • 3. Moruya Markets: Held every Saturday morning, the Moruya Markets are a must-visit for locals and tourists alike. Here, you can find a wide range of fresh produce, local crafts, clothing, and delicious food stalls.
  • 4. Moruya Golf Club: Golf enthusiasts will enjoy a round of golf at the Moruya Golf Club. This picturesque course offers stunning views of the surrounding countryside and is suitable for players of all skill levels.
  • 5. Moruya River: The Moruya River is a popular spot for fishing, boating, kayaking, and swimming. Take a relaxing boat trip along the river or simply enjoy a picnic by its banks.

About “Virtual Interlining”: Some itineraries may combine multiple airlines without a traditional interline agreement. This can unlock routes that are otherwise hard to find, but it can also increase complexity (separate tickets, tighter connections, baggage rules, and responsibility for missed connections).
